## Test Plan — Coldvault Archival

Verify Coldvault archives buckets idle >180 days. Steps: seed three test buckets, backdate last-access, run the archiver in dry-run, confirm manifest lists all three, then run live and verify tombstone markers. Rollback: restore from manifest within 7 days. Dry-run invocation hits the staging API and needs bearer auth; use the token below:

portal login ticket: eyJhbGciOiJIUzI1NiIsInR5cCI6IkpXVCJ9.eyJzdWIiOiIMjvRAf3PEFIn0.nuv9gjixLtnr

Handover Note — Franchise Agreement, Velmara Coffee Works

For department heads: I'm passing the Velmara franchise file to Director Ostrand effective Monday. Renewal terms with the Drayfield outlet are agreed in principle; royalty rates unchanged, territory clause still under legal review. Expect signature within three weeks. The note below outlines our confidential position on expansion.

board note of fahag-tajop: The eastern region missed its Julix quota by 44.0 percent last quarter. Ralionax Holdings plans to lower the Druath list price by 61.8 percent in March. The board signed off on a budget of $295.0 million for Project Gilath. The renewal with Ruswynix Systems closes at $274.5 million a year, 17.0 percent above the last contract.

Training Budget FY Next — Managers Only

This page summarizes the approved training allocation for next year across Ostrava Dynamics divisions. Finance should book the full amount to cost center group TRN under the new Harlow framework. Quarterly releases replace the old annual lump sum, so forecast accordingly. Unused funds lapse at year end; no carryover exceptions will be granted. Reconciliation is due within ten working days of each quarter close. The following note is confidential and must not leave this page.

internal memo for fajog-yagaf: Gross margin on Ulaael came in at 20 percent against a plan of 10 percent. Only 9 of the 80 pilot accounts renewed Ulaael, so a churn review is set for July 1.